Firebrands - Portraits from the Americas

(Microcosm) In answer to the Texas textbook mafia controlling what kids get to learn in school this is a collection of short, deftly illustrated biographies of American (including South American) heroes and martyrs of the left, including Angela Davis, Sitting Bull, Ida B. Wells, Audrey Lord, Pablo Neruda, and dozens more. This include unlikely entries (Tupac, Studs Terkel), controversial figures (Fred Hapton, John Brown) and mostly people you have not heard of but will learn about here. Whether kids will read this is another question, and the fact that they sometimes use the same kind of one sided history as their right wing rivals makes this imperfect, but what's perfect? And I love the drawings.
